Contruction season begins in Kenora

It’s officially construction season in Kenora.

A section of Ninth Street North will be closed for much of the summer.

Starting today there will be construction in the area between Mellick Avenue and Main Street Rideout.

The city says underground infrastructure like sewer and water and road improvements are going to be made.

The work is expected to last until October.

A detour route has been set out from Rupert Road to 10th Street North and to Main Street Rideout.

Back lanes will also be open but will be for local traffic only.

A second closure on 9th Street North will also take place this week.

The section from 12th Avenue North to 13th Avenue North will take place starting on Thursday.

That section of road will be closed altogether from 7 am till 7 pm Monday to Friday until early September for the replacement storm sewer infrastructure and resurfacing the road.

Also, the section of 1st Street South will be closed to traffic from Chipman Street to the roundabout on Tuesday for construction

The closure will last from 7 am until 6 pm.
